Hi! Welcome to Inox Converter official page!
|
8
10
|
Our gem is created to work like a 'swiss army knife' for Ruby developers, bringing a easy and reliable way to convert some formats and units that commonly appear during the developing process.
|
9
|
-
You can: convert area, currency, length, mass, volume and format time and date.
|
11
|
+
You can: convert area, currency(real time), length, mass, volume and format time and date.
|
10
12
|
You want to use one unit that doesn't exist in our gem? You can add that unit too!
|
11
13
|
And more... As a framework you can extend our gem and create your own convertions type.
